    How to File a Car Accident Claim

    If you've been in an accident with a vehicle It's imperative to take the necessary steps to have your claim processed. This includes contacting your insurance and obtaining essential information like the contact details of the other driver.

    You may also need to provide additional information and documents, such as copies of the police report and medical records. Informing your insurance company promptly can help them investigate the accident and determine who was at fault.

    Medical Treatment

    If you've suffered injuries in an automobile accident it is essential to see a medical professional as soon as you can. This will prevent the accident from causing more injuries, which could lead to more damage or illness.

    You will be more successful in proving your claim to compensation if you seek medical attention as soon as possible. It will be easier for you to prove that your injury was caused by the car accident , and that it required treatment.

    Many people are tempted avoid seeking medical attention after an accident. This is often a mistake. While minor aches, pains or swelling may not be serious but they can quickly turn more severe and life-threatening if not treated promptly. Defense lawyers and insurance adjusters will often attempt to use the fact that you failed to seek medical treatment in order to reject your claim for compensation.

    It is also essential to obtain a medical note from your doctor if suffer from serious injuries or driving at the time of the collision. This will assist you and our legal team to establish a causal connection between the accident and your injuries. This can help you prove that the other driver was responsible for the accident.

    Your doctor might refer you to a specialist depending on the condition you are in. This will allow you to receive the best treatment and speed up your treatment. It is also crucial to follow up with any diagnostic tests or referrals by filling prescriptions, car accident attorneys as well as performing the recommended exercises at home.

    You should also keep in the mind that your health insurance coverage will cover your medical bills following an accident in the car, so long you have an insurance policy that is valid. This is especially relevant if you have personal injury protection (PIP) coverage.

    If, however, you are not insured , or if your insurance policy does not cover medical expenses it could be necessary to pay for your own medical expenses. This could be a major financial burden and it is advised to seek help from an experienced attorney to safeguard your rights in obtaining fair compensation.

    Damages

    In a car accident case, you could be entitled to a range of damages. These can include economic and non-economic damages.

    Economic damage is the financial losses you have suffered such as lost wages and medical bills. The amount you will be awarded for these damages is determined on the severity of your injuries.

    Noneconomic damages, such as emotional trauma, as well as loss of quality of life, could also be claimed. These are the kinds of damages that can have a major impact on your life and the enjoyment you get from it.

    They are typically awarded in a personal injuries lawsuit. They can be determined in a variety of ways but the most accurate method of determining their value is with the help of an experienced attorney.

    A personal injury attorney can determine the value of your claim reviewing all of your medical records as well as expenses related to your injuries. Without documentation, you could be awarded less than you should or even be denied a damages award completely.

    Injuries can cause significant costs and even permanent disability. They can also limit your ability to work, earn a living and enjoy the things you are passionate about.

    Accident claims for car accidents are often not dealt with quickly by insurance companies. It is important to file your claim promptly. The quicker you submit your claim, the quicker you can get it resolved and the greater amount of money you can collect from the insurance company of the driver who is at fault.

    Take photos of the scene and any damage to property to document the incident. You should also obtain an official police report to support your case.

    Once you have a strong evidence of the car crash, your attorney can start working on your damages. This could take a long time so it is crucial to get in touch with a lawyer right away after the crash.

    Our car accident lawyers can claim both economic and non-economic damages on your behalf so that you will get the entire amount of your losses. These damages could include medical expenses, loss of wages, pain and suffering, and punitive damages.

    Liability

    Your insurance company will initially be looking for the person who caused the accident. This is vital because it will determine the amount of compensation you'll receive for your damages. You may be able to receive compensation for many damages depending the location you live in, such as medical bills loss of wages, property damage.

    In the majority of cases, the driver who caused the accident is accountable for their actions. This could be a singular person, or even a group.

    Your attorney must establish that the other driver was at fault or negligent to determine liability for a car crash. It can be a challenge, but necessary to receive an equitable and complete amount of compensation.

    The first step is to obtain an official police report from the scene of the accident. This will assist your attorney argue for the cause and ensure that you are compensated for any losses you may have.

    You should also get as much information as possible from the other driver after an accident. This can include their driver's license numberas well as their contact information, and insurance information.

    You should also consult an experienced medical professional as soon as you can after the incident. You can achieve a complete recovery if you receive the proper treatment.

    After you have sought medical treatment The doctor will conduct a thorough examination of your injuries. It will also record your medical history as well as other relevant data that can be used as evidence if you decide to bring a lawsuit against the other party.

    In spite of the person who was responsible for the accident Your insurance company will want proof that you've been treated properly and provided the attention you required. They will also want to ensure that your treatment was completed in accordance to their guidelines.

    Negligence is the most common type of claim in car accidents. This can involve the driver of a vehicle or another driver on motorcycle or bicycle, or even pedestrians.

    Legal Representation

    If you or a loved one is involved in an accident, it is recommended that you seek legal advice from a lawyer for car accidents. An attorney can help you file your claim to negotiate a settlement with the insurance company and also pursue litigation in court if necessary.

    A lot of car accident lawsuit accidents result in serious injuries that can impact your life for many years to come. These injuries can result in severe emotional trauma, financial loss as well as physical discomfort. These injuries can also hinder your ability to work as well as your ability to live your life to the fullest.

    A seasoned Philadelphia car Accident attorneys accident lawyer can help you obtain compensation for your losses. These damages can include medical bills, lost earnings and other costs that are beyond your control.

    A skilled car accident lawyer will be able to explain the law and procedural regulations that could affect your case. This is essential to ensure that you receive the fair and reasonable compensation you are entitled to.

    If someone dies in a car crash the family members of the deceased have up to two years to file a wrongful-death lawsuit. Sufferers can also sue for their pain and suffering.

    Without the help of an experienced lawyer, it may be difficult to receive the amount of compensation you deserve. In addition, insurers will often contest the extent of your injuries, and attempt to minimize the amount that you receive.

    It is important to immediately engage an attorney following an accident. An attorney can give you valuable advice and guidance through each step of the process.

    An attorney will have access to numerous experts, including economists and accident reconstruction experts. These experts can help determine the true value of your case as well as identify factors that could impact the final verdict.

    In addition to the economic damages you might also be able to seek non-economic damages, such as pain and suffering and emotional trauma. In extreme instances, punitive damages may be awarded.

    Keep in mind that personal injury claims in New York are subject to a three-year statute of limitations. This means that you must file your claim within the time limit to be eligible for damages.
